JQuery是一個非常強大的JavaScript庫,它可以方便地操作HTML文檔,其中包括input元素。當我們需要檢測鼠標是否離開input元素時,我們可以使用JQuery提供的mouseleave事件。
// 鼠標移出input元素時觸發(fā) $("input").mouseleave(function(){ // 在此處添加您想要執(zhí)行的代碼 });
上面的代碼告訴JQuery,在任何一個input元素上鼠標離開時觸發(fā)mouseleave事件。在此事件中,您可以添加任何您想要執(zhí)行的代碼,如驗證用戶輸入的數據,或者在鼠標離開時隱藏提示框。
請注意,在mouseleave事件中,如果您只想在用戶第一次離開input元素時執(zhí)行代碼,可以使用JQuery提供的one()方法。一旦代碼被執(zhí)行,該事件就會從input元素上取消注冊。
// 只在第一次鼠標移出input元素時執(zhí)行 $("input").one("mouseleave", function(){ // 在此處添加您想要執(zhí)行的代碼 });
上面的代碼告訴JQuery,在任何一個input元素上第一次鼠標離開時觸發(fā)mouseleave事件。一旦代碼被執(zhí)行,該事件就會從input元素上取消注冊。
總之,JQuery的mouseleave事件可以方便地檢測鼠標是否離開input元素,并且提供了非常靈活的函數編程方式,可以輕松實現(xiàn)各種功能。